December 2007 Special Session
STATE OF WISCONSIN
Senate Journal
The Senate met.
The Senate was called to order by President Risser.
__________________
Call of Roll
The roll was called and the following Senators answered to their names:
Senators Breske, Carpenter, Coggs, Decker, S. Fitzgerald, Hansen, Kanavas, Kreitlow, Lassa, Lehman, Miller, Plale, Risser, Robson, Sullivan, Taylor, Vinehout and Wirch - 18.
Absent - Senators Cowles, Darling, Ellis, Erpenbach, Grothman, Harsdorf, Jauch, Kapanke, Kedzie, A. Lasee, Lazich, Leibham, Olsen, Roessler and Schultz - 15.
Absent with leave - None.
The Senate stood for the prayer which was offered by Reverend David Susan, recently retired from Immanuel Lutheran Church in Madison.
The Senate remained standing and Senator Lassa led the Senate in the pledge of allegiance to the flag of the United States of America.
__________________
Adjournment
Senator Decker, with unanimous consent, asked that the December 2007 Special Session adjourn until Tuesday, February 5, 2008.
Adjourned.
11:10 A.M.
